The new RVA NSW Regional Manger, Mark Eagleston, has distributed a very good overview of the Retirement Villages Act Amendment Bill that was passed through NSW Parliament on 4 December, with release of regulations expected first quarter 2009. In particular it reviews the new requirements on settling in periods, capital replacement funds, capital gains, capital maintenance and recurrent charges.
